Judge Grimm’s decision in Victor Stanley case

Judge Grimm’s decision in the Victor Stanley case has a chilling effect on lawyers who craft their own key word searches, absent advice from experts who can provide quality assurance and quality control. Read Craig Ball’s article about it (registration required).
